What was permitted

Residents in Bedford-Stuyvesant (East) can gain insight into the costs of essential building infrastructure upgrades. This permit is for structural work related to an interior renovation of a NYCHA boiler, specifically involving the replacement of concrete pads.

The permit was issued on April 6, 2026, with an estimated cost of $15,000. DYNAMIC US, INC is the general contractor for this structural project.
